About the Role

  • Suitable candidate will be responsible for acting as the drainage lead on projects working under their own initiative and providing updates to Clients and will also provide support and guidance to junior staff where necessary.
  • Must have sufficient experience in all aspects of drainage network design, including design of pipework, surface water channels, gullies, and attenuation systems.  
  • Must have experience in flow estimation and catchment analysis.
  • Must have experience in culvert design to CIRIA guidance and must have completed OPW Section 50 applications.
  • Must have a knowledge and understanding of the TII drainage publications, and an understanding of the Greater Dublin Regional Code of Practice for Drainage Works, and knowledge of DMURS and the SuDS manual.

 


What do we need from you

  • BSc Civil Engineering or equivalent as a minimum plus a minimum of 7 years of experience working on Drainage Design for large scale Civil Infrastructure projects.
  • Must have skills in drainage design to both TII publications and DMURS projects.
  • Proficient in MicroDrainage or similar.
  • Proficient in HEC-RAS modelling or similar
  • Proficient in CulvertMaster or similar.
